

Born in 1995 from the split of NSW’s Electricity Commission, it evolved into Australia’s largest high
voltage grid operator.
Manages over 13,000 km of transmission lines and 104 substations across NSW and the ACT, linking into the National Electricity Market.
Over a decade, rolled out a A$16.5 billion upgrade program, including mega
projects like EnergyConnect and HumeLink to reinforce energy superhighways.
Commercial arm Lumea has added 55+ renewable generators, contributing to the clean energy transition.
Backed by a major consortium including Spark, Utilities Trust of Australia, CDPQ, ADIA, and OMERS following a A$10.3 billion lease deal in 2015.
Key projects include the multi
state HumeLink (underway) and VNI West interconnector, despite community pushback.
Despite challenges, remains pivotal to Australia’s clean
energy transition.
